Diferencia entre almacenes de datos orientados a filas y orientados a columnas en DBMS

Un almacén de datos es básicamente un lugar para almacenar colecciones de datos, como una base de datos, un sistema de archivos o un directorio. En el sistema de base de datos se pueden almacenar de dos maneras. Estos son los siguientes: Almacenes de datos orientados a filas Almacenes de datos orientados a columnas Las … Continue reading «Diferencia entre almacenes de datos orientados a filas y orientados a columnas en DBMS»

Evaluación de consulta relacional | Serie 1

Existe la necesidad de convertir la consulta relacional en expresiones algebraicas. Esta expresión se opera para que se reciba la salida final. Los operadores de álgebra relacional que están presentes son Union, Select, Join, Project, etc. Estos se utilizan para formular consultas relacionales para obtener resultados adecuados. La agrupación, partición y agregación son todas partes … Continue reading «Evaluación de consulta relacional | Serie 1»

Restricciones en el modelo de base de datos relacional

Al modelar el diseño de la base de datos relacional , podemos poner algunas restricciones, como qué valores se permiten insertar en la relación, qué tipo de modificaciones y eliminaciones se permiten en la relación. Estas son las restricciones que imponemos en la base de datos relacional.  En modelos como los modelos ER, no teníamos … Continue reading «Restricciones en el modelo de base de datos relacional»

Evaluación de consulta relacional | conjunto 2

Requisito previo: evaluación de consulta relacional | Conjunto 1 Los datos se almacenan en discos. Luego, los discos se manipulan mediante métodos de lectura y escritura. A mayor número de manipulaciones, menor número de discos estarían fallando. Para superar esto y aumentar la vida útil de los discos, queremos optimizar los discos usados ​​asegurándonos de … Continue reading «Evaluación de consulta relacional | conjunto 2»

Operadores básicos en álgebra relacional

Conceptos básicos del modelo relacional: modelo relacional  El álgebra relacional es un lenguaje de consulta procedimental que toma relaciones como entrada y las devuelve como salida. Hay algunos operadores básicos que se pueden aplicar en las relaciones para producir los resultados requeridos que discutiremos uno por uno. Usaremos las relaciones ESTUDIANTE_DEPORTES, EMPLEADO y ESTUDIANTE como … Continue reading «Operadores básicos en álgebra relacional»

Forma Clausal en Bases de Datos Deductivas

En forma de cláusula , la fórmula se compone de una serie de cláusulas, donde cada cláusula se compone de una serie de literales conectados solo por conectores lógicos OR. Una fórmula puede tener los siguientes cuantificadores : Cuantificador universal:  se puede entender como: «Para todo x, P(x) se cumple», lo que significa que P(x) … Continue reading «Forma Clausal en Bases de Datos Deductivas»

Diferencia entre almacenes de datos orientados a filas y orientados a columnas en DBMS – Part 1

Un almacén de datos es básicamente un lugar para almacenar colecciones de datos, como una base de datos, un sistema de archivos o un directorio. En el sistema de base de datos se pueden almacenar de dos maneras. Estos son los siguientes: Almacenes de datos orientados a filas Almacenes de datos orientados a columnas Las … Continue reading «Diferencia entre almacenes de datos orientados a filas y orientados a columnas en DBMS – Part 1»

Número de relaciones que son tanto irreflexivas como antisimétricas en un conjunto

Dado un entero positivo N , la tarea es encontrar el número de relaciones que son relaciones antisimétricas irreflexivas que se pueden formar sobre el conjunto de elementos dado. Dado que el conteo puede ser muy grande, imprímalo en módulo 10 9 + 7 . Una relación R sobre un conjunto A se llama reflexiva … Continue reading «Número de relaciones que son tanto irreflexivas como antisimétricas en un conjunto»

Diferencia entre álgebra relacional y cálculo relacional

Tanto el álgebra relacional como el cálculo relacional son lenguajes de consulta formales.  Álgebra relacional: El álgebra relacional es un lenguaje procedimental. En Álgebra Relacional, se especifica el orden en que se deben realizar las operaciones. En Álgebra Relacional , se crean marcos para implementar las consultas. Las operaciones básicas incluidas en el álgebra relacional … Continue reading «Diferencia entre álgebra relacional y cálculo relacional»

Diferencia entre clave principal y clave única

Requisito previo: claves en el modelo relacional  Una clave principal es una columna de la tabla que identifica de manera única cada tupla (fila) en esa tabla. La clave principal impone restricciones de integridad a la tabla. Solo se permite usar una clave principal en una tabla. La clave principal no acepta ningún valor duplicado … Continue reading «Diferencia entre clave principal y clave única»